bngvixqjyj 发表于 2025-8-6 15:28:24

问下大家,为啥这些 ai 喜欢搞 cli 模式?

克劳德 cli    gemini cli
等等他们为啥都喜欢搞命令行,搞个页面或者搞个 ide 不好吗?

暮色回响 发表于 2025-8-6 15:29:47

这个问题类似于为什么还有人喜欢用 vim 编辑器

1x2s 发表于 2025-8-6 15:31:30

因为大部分程序员其实还是挺喜欢命令行界面(CLI)模式的

快日水 发表于 2025-8-6 15:38:31

CLI 怎么就方便了?最方便的难道不应该是 API 吗?

冷兔 发表于 2025-8-6 15:43:13

CLI多方便呀,安装就只要一行命令,配置也不过几行命令,谁乐意在一堆UI界面里点来点去的

你是我的 发表于 2025-8-6 15:47:13

使用命令行界面(CLI),学习集成开发环境(IDE)的成本为零,无需学习新的 IDE,也不用配置新的环境。CLI 的功能一目了然,无需在界面中翻找。在自己熟悉的 IDE 中修改代码、进行调试也十分顺手。

yangshouz 发表于 2025-8-7 09:28:18

CLI真的很好用啊

粉熊心 发表于 2025-8-7 09:37:33

适配性强(可应用于 CI 中)、开发便捷(更便于编写测试)

Гучин 发表于 2025-8-7 09:56:44

IDE嘛,好多产品都在做呀,像Cursor、Windsurf、Trae……以插件形式存在的也不少呢。

CLI很简单,等后端把业务打通之后再发展IDE就行,要是直接做IDE,那就得考虑大量前端交互的问题了。

新乐光 发表于 7 天前

克劳德命令行界面(CLI)
双子座命令行界面(CLI)

等等,他们为啥都喜欢弄命令行啊,做个页面或者弄个集成开发环境(IDE)不好吗?

cfang99 发表于 6 天前

你肯定不是程序员

t608 发表于 6 天前

方便呀。

绿火 发表于 5 天前

举个爪
我在vi和vim的使用上,基本都靠肌肉记忆了。
毕竟能记住的Linux命令没多少。

maojianmi 发表于 3 天前

让你每天更换集成开发环境(IDE),你愿意吗?这个用习惯了,很难换过来的。

冷雨乐 发表于 昨天 06:06

方便呀
啥环境都能弄,各种云开发平台devbox,网页ide都能使用
页: [1]
查看完整版本: 问下大家,为啥这些 ai 喜欢搞 cli 模式?